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"mental health programme"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when referring to a structured plan or initiative aimed at promoting mental well-being or providing support for mental health issues. Example: "The organization has launched a new mental health programme to support employees dealing with stress and anxiety."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When writing about mental health initiatives, clearly define the specific goals and target audience of the "mental health programme" to ensure clarity and relevance.
Common error
Avoid using "mental health programme" as a catch-all term. Be specific about the programme's focus, whether it's for anxiety, depression, or general well-being, to prevent ambiguity.

FAQs
What is the main goal of a "mental health programme"?
The primary goal of a "mental health programme" is to promote mental well-being, prevent mental health issues, and provide support for individuals experiencing mental health challenges.
What are some alternatives to "mental health programme"?
You can use alternatives like "mental wellness program", "psychological support initiative", or "emotional health scheme" depending on the context.
How does a "mental health programme" differ from general healthcare?
A "mental health programme" specifically targets mental and emotional well-being, whereas general healthcare encompasses a broader range of physical and mental health services. They often intersect, but the focus differs.
Who typically benefits from a "mental health programme"?
A wide range of individuals can benefit, including those with diagnosed mental health conditions, individuals experiencing stress or burnout, and anyone seeking to improve their overall emotional well-being.
